Kühne choses Turkey as supply center for ME & Asian markets

Kühne a German food company famous for its salad dressings has started a major investment for vinegar production in the Aegean city of Izmir.

Currently, the company has a vinegar production facility in Afyon and has made a well-deserved reputation for its product group.

The company is scheduled to invest an amount of TRY 8.5 million in its new operation with an annual capacity 10,000 ton and is determined to turn Turkey into a supply hub for its Middle Eastern and Central Asian markets.

Kühne believes that Turkey is an attractive country for it offers great opportunities for the close future, on top of the fact that Turkey’s growing economy and its strategic position allows easy access to the Middle East, Asia and Europe.
